Graduates of the Navy ROTC commit to at least five years of active duty in careers within surface warfare, naval aviation, submarines, nursing corps, special warfare and explosive ordnance disposal. Scholarship and non-scholarship participants in NROTC complete the same program. Scholarships can be for 4-Years, 3-Years, or 2-Years. The 3-Year and 2-Year scholarships may also require attendance at a summer training course at Fort Knox, KY, if any of the freshman or sophomore Army ROTC classes were not taken.If nursing is your professional goal, there is no better place to begin your career than Army ROTC. Nursing school + ROTC is structured differently than regular ROTC to be more accommodating to upper level clinicals junior and senior year. Active Duty Officers: Variable special pay of $1,200 to $12,000 annually, based on length of service. Board certification pay of $2,500 to $6,000 annually for board-certified physicians. Medical additional special pay of $15,000. If a student chooses the Navy ROTC nursing program, however, he only has to commit to four years of active duty service. To be eligible for a Navy ROTC scholarship, a person must be a citizen of the United States and at least 17 years old by September 1 of his freshman year of college, but not older than 23 by June 30 of his …
